Job Responsibilities
The role and the duties of the unarmed security officer vary significantly depending on the type and the location of the job.
The Unarmed Security Guard is responsible for the following:
- Performing protective service work and ensure prevention of any loss of assets
- Following all company policies regarding safety and abide by the duties assigned to him
- Working on any weekends and holidays
- Working long hours (over time) whenever required
- Providing quality customer services and communicating with personnel
- Handling every situation which arises during his duty hours with courage and wisdom
- Maintaining confidentiality about people living or working in the area where he is posted
- Keeping record on a daily basis concerning all the activities during his shift
- Writing special reports regarding any accidents or unusual incidents that might take place during his duty hours
- Patrolling facility to ensure security and safety
- Examining doors, windows, and gates
- Regulating vehicle and pedestrian traffic for smooth flow
- Reporting problematic situations like fire hazards, leaking water pipes, etc.
- Calling police or fire department if the situation demands
Academic and Skill sets
To work as an Unarmed Security Officer one must be at least of 18 years of age (some companies, mostly US companies, require the candidate to be of 21 years of age or older). Other requirements to qualify as Security Officer are as follows:
- High School Diploma or GED. However, some companies don't require even this. Pass the background check and undergo at the same time clearing the drug screening test
- Must have an appropriate state certification or guard card (Unarmed Security Guard License) of the area. (Not required by some of the companies as they will get you the card by themselves once you are hired)
- Willing to work in different shifts, days, evenings and nights
- Must be mature, trustworthy and responsible
- Must be alert and a good observer
- Must have a valid driver's license with clean vehicle record (some companies even require the candidates to own transport)
- Should not have any criminal records in the past
- Must be able to work on weekends and holidays (some companies might not require this)
- Must have good communication and interpersonal skills
- Must have basic mathematical skills
- Must be responsive with good reasoning ability
- Must be present minded to take immediate action whenever required
- Must be able to follow clear instructions and report things properly to the supervisors

Prior Experience
One can also work as a temporary security officer. An Unarmed Security Officer is an entry level position. Therefore most of the companies don't require experience and one can get experience while on the job. Some of the companies may ask for 1 to 2 years of experience. Experienced candidates are always preferred over inexperienced ones.

Salaries
Usually Unarmed Security Officers are paid on an hourly basis as they work on shifts and their shift timings may vary considerably. They have to work overtime as well as on weekends and holidays. The normal pay is $8.00 per hour which can go up to $18.00 per hour. The annual average salary is about $39,000.
If the Security Officer fulfills his duties properly, observes timings, and shows good performance then there are bright chances that an unarmed security officer will get a hike in payment.
